Atlanta, Georgia, 8/26/2009 - Reflex Systems, the pioneer in virtualization management, compliance and security, today announced that Reflex Virtualization Management Center (VMC) is the first third-party solution to be certified by VMware for VMsafetm, VMware's hypervisor-embedded security solution for ISV partners.
Since VMsafe applications are embedded in the hypervisor, VMware's certification program ensures that third-party software does not adversely affect the functionality of the vSphere v4 platform. The certification also verifies that a VMsafe solution does not impact the performance of the hypervisor. Solutions that pass the certification are tested for their interaction and compatibility with all of vSphere v4’s major features and functionality.

Reflex VMC with vTrust utilizes VMware's VMsafe API to deliver a more granular level of visibility and control into communication within the VMware virtual environment. vTrust allows more sophisticated segmentation (virtual trust zones), policy enforcement as well as monitoring, filtering and control of VM-to-VM traffic. Additional features include asset classification, virtual trust zones, dynamic network control, and adaptive roaming policies that move with assets regardless of physical location, or network connection. Reflex's relationship with VMware enables the company to leverage VMware VMsafe technology to enforce network policies through a module embedded in the hypervisor in VMware vSphere 4.
